A Christian Eriksen goal early in the second half gave Spurs their first home Premier League win of the season as they defeated Bournemouth 1-0. The first 45 minutes were largely forgettable, with the visitors intent on keeping men behind the ball and Tottenham lacking either the pace or the guile to find a way through. Indeed it was the visitors who came close to breaking the deadlock with two chances inside a minute midway through the first period.
The game opened out after Spurs took the lead but Tottenham were unable to add to their tally. Unlike against Burnley when they conceded a late equaliser, this time Spurs held on through a nervy last 20 minutes to take all three points.
